We installed the Art Creek theme but the hero image on our homepage is less wide than the hero image on the demo website.

When I look at the code, I see a class td-boxed-layout in the body tag. I don’t know how to switch the boxed layout to fullwidth lay-out.
I read in the forum that the website automatically switches to boxed when adding a background but we haven’t added a background so that can’t be the reason. I haven’t found a setting to switch to boxed anywhere in the theme settings, neither in the page settings.
Searching for “box” or “boxed” in the theme documentation doesn’t give any relevant hits.
Please advice how we can switch the website from boxed to fullwidth.

Indeed that will be the case, the website will be boxed when a background color or image is set in the theme panel

From what I can see there is a background color set on the website at the moment, a black color. Please check the theme background color section and clear the color found there
